What companies run services between High Barnet, England and Frinton-on-Sea, England?
There is no direct connection from High Barnet to Frinton-on-Sea. However, you can take the subway to Moorgate station, walk to London Liverpool Street, take the train to Clacton-on-Sea, walk to Railway Station, then take the bus to The Oaks. Alternatively, you can drive from High Barnet to Frinton-on-Sea in around 1h 37m.
